WebMar 1, 2024 · The 5 behaviors of effective teams at Google were: psychological safety, dependability, structure and clarity, meaning, and impact. Psychological Safety: How much risk team members perceive and what consequences they believe they may face when asking a question, suggesting a new idea, or owning up to a problem (in essence, the … WebNov 11, 2024 · Google, in 2012, embarked in an interesting research initiative on team effectiveness code-named Project Aristotle. They wanted to know why some teams excelled while the other stumbled.

Following the success of Google’s Project Oxygen, where the people analytics team studied what makes an effective manager, Google embarked on Project Aristotle to discover what makes an effective team at Google. Google named their project after Aristotle because of his famous quotation: "the whole is greater than ...
